Duties and Responsibilities
· Source and map ESG data to support sustainable investment analytics for regulatory and client reporting
· Utilize tools like Python, Power BI/Tableau for the analysis and visualization of ESG data, delivering promptly upon reporting requirements
· Keep up to date with ESG regulations, notably in the EU (SFDR, CSRD etc.) and the UK and emerging regulations and disclosure standards (e.g. IFRS ISSB)
· Contribute to the improvement and automation of our ESG data sourcing, processing, analysis, and reporting practices including evaluating external data and solution partnerships
· Lead development and integration of AI solutions within the Global ESG space to the Global Sustainable Investment team
· Act as the central point of contact on ESG data aggregation, working with the wider business to define, test and implement a central repository of key data for use across the firm
· Oversee and execute proper maintenance of systems and databases to ensure the accuracy and integrity of ESG data, including development of a common ESG taxonomy and data catalogue
· Advise business on ESG data availability and how to effectively utilize ESG data for strategic decision-making
· Work on various ESG data projects with internal stakeholders, incl. global sustainable investment team, investment teams, risk, client services, product to meet reporting requirements and enhance ESG solutions
· Develop various ESG reporting templates and analytics tools for investment teams. This assistance is operational support in nature
· Ensure the firm’s ESG data capabilities are kept up todate in line with changing regulatory environments and evolving client and business needs
· Provide ESG data inputs and analytical support for enterprise-wide projects such as climate stress testing, focusing on research and operational processes
